Here is an overview of the healthcare infrastructure around the holiday apartment in Kraichtal:

1. Doctors:

• Dr. Markus Freitag (Specialist in Internal Medicine) is located at Untere Hofstadt 3, Kraichtal.

• There are additional practices in the area, e.g., Dr. Herbert von Neumann-Cosel (Internal Medicine) at Hauptstraße 131, Kraichtal.

• General practitioner Dr. Gerda Korp is located approximately 1.3 km away.


2. Pharmacies:

• The nearest pharmacy, Brunnen-Apotheke, is located in Unteröwisheim, about 1.5 km away.

3. Hospitals and Clinics:

• The Rechberg Clinic in Bretten (approx. 10 km away) offers general medical care.

• The hospital in Bruchsal is called RKH Fürst-Stirum-Klinik Bruchsal (approx. 15 km away). It offers a wide range of medical specialties and services.

The Kraichtal region and its surroundings offer a wealth of leisure activities and excursions for both adults and families with children. The gentle rolling hills, charming villages, and diverse attractions make the area an ideal destination for relaxation and adventure. Here are some highlights and recommendations:

1. Nature Experiences and Outdoor Activities

• Hiking and Cycling Trails: The region is crisscrossed by a well-developed network of hiking and cycling trails leading through vineyards, forests, and picturesque villages. Especially recommended are the Kraichgau-Stromberg Trail and the Wine Hiking Trail around Michaelsberg.

• Canoe Tours on the Neckar: A trip on the river offers wonderful views of the surrounding hills and historic towns like Heidelberg.

• Picnics in Nature: Beautiful spots such as Eichelberg or the forests near Bretten invite you to enjoy relaxing hours surrounded by nature.

2. Sights and Culture

• Heidelberg Castle: A trip to the world-famous castle with its impressive view over the Neckar River is a must. A tour of the castle can be ideally combined with a stroll through the old town.

• Sinsheim Technology Museum: A highlight for technology enthusiasts and families. Visitors can marvel at real airplanes, classic cars, and much more.

• Karlsruhe: With Karlsruhe Palace and the attached Baden State Museum, there is much to discover, followed by a walk through the palace gardens.

• Maulbronn Monastery: This well-preserved monastic complex is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and a memorable experience for both adults and children.

3. Amusement Parks and Family Attractions

• Tripsdrill Adventure Park: Located near Cleebronn, this park is known for its combination of adventure, nature, and wildlife park. It offers numerous attractions and rides for all ages.

• Schwarzach Wildlife Park: A popular destination for families to observe native wildlife and let children have fun on one of the adventure playgrounds.

• Aquadrom Hockenheim Water Park: On rainy days, this indoor water park offers fun for young and old with water slides, wave pools, and wellness areas.

4. Culinary Experiences

• Wine Tastings and Traditional Taverns: The region is renowned for its wine production. Many wineries offer guided tours and tastings where guests can enjoy local specialties.

• Farm Shops and Regional Markets: Fresh regional products can be found at weekly markets and in charming farm shops, many of which also have small cafés serving homemade cakes and snacks.

5. Seasonal Events

• Wine Festivals and Farmers' Markets: During the warmer months, numerous festivals and markets invite visitors to sample regional delicacies and wines.

• Medieval Markets and Knight Tournaments: Some towns, such as Bad Wimpfen, host medieval festivals featuring music, crafts, and performances — a wonderful experience, especially for families.

6. Education and Workshops

• Children’s Programs in Museums: Many museums in the region, such as the Natural History Museum in Karlsruhe, offer special programs and workshops for children.

• Botanical Garden Heidelberg: A peaceful place to explore the world of plants and participate in family-friendly guided tours.

The Kraichtal region and the surrounding towns offer a perfect blend of relaxation, adventure, and culture for all age groups — ideal for a weekend getaway or a longer stay.

7. Swimming and Lakes

• Hardtsee in Ubstadt: This lake impresses with its clear water and well-maintained sunbathing lawns, perfect for relaxing and enjoying sunny days.

• Freizeitsee Forst (also known as Heidesee): A hidden gem for water sports enthusiasts and families — with beautiful shore areas and a pleasant atmosphere, it’s the perfect spot to fully enjoy summer days.

Not to be forgotten is the Sasch swimming pool in Bruchsal. This modern swimming oasis not only offers a large pool for athletic swimming but also areas for fun and relaxation, including children's pools and cozy relaxation zones. A highlight is the combination of indoor and outdoor areas, allowing visitors to enjoy a refreshing break in any weather.

Whether swimming outdoors or relaxing by the water — Hardtsee in Ubstadt, Heidesee in Forst, and the Sasch swimming pool in Bruchsal offer unforgettable water experiences for young and old alike, all set in an idyllic environment.

8. Playgrounds

There are four playgrounds in Oberöwisheim located in the following areas:

At Römerweg
Facilities:
Toddler seesaw, play tower with slide, swing, monkey bars, sandbox, and a merry-go-round.
Benches are available.

Neuenweg / Bachstraße
Facilities:
Jumping net, zip line, combination play structure, triple swing, rotating monkey bar, spring rockers, playhouse, and a table tennis table.

Mühlhälden
Facilities:
Spring rocker, slide, double swing, pirate ship with hammock, and balance beam.
Benches are available.

Forest Playground "Pfannwaldsee"
Facilities:
Double chain swing, two-seater seesaw, and a barbecue hut with a fire pit.
Wooden benches are available inside the hut.

Use of the barbecue area is only permitted with prior registration at the city of Kraichtal.
